Plant Co-Defensive Coordinator Matt Johnson, leaving Plant

Plant Co-Defensive Coordinator Matt Johnson is leaving Plant and and returning to Michigan. It has not been determined if Johnson will continue his coaching career when he returns, but it is certain that he will be missed.

Johnson spent the last three seasons as the Co-Defensive Coordinator (with John Few), defensive backs coach (with Bo Puckett) and has been a key member of the Plant staff since the spring of 2004, under interim head football coach, Mike McWilliams in the spring of ’04. Under Johnson and Few, the Plant defenses allowed an average of just 191 points per year to their opponents playing more than 13 games a year in that span. Prior to joining the Plant staff, Johnson spent one season coaching at Durant.

Interesting fact: Johnson was a walk on at Michigan for the football team whom eventually earned a scholarship.
